Dame Angela Brigid Lansbury (October 16, 1925 – October 11, 2022) was an Irish-British and American actress and singer. In a career spanning eighty years, she played various roles across film, stage, and television. Although based for much of her life in the United States, her work attracted international attention.

“I'm eternally grateful for the Irish side of me. That's where I got my sense of comedy and whimsy. As for the English half — that's my reserved side ... But put me onstage, and the Irish comes out. The combination makes a good mix for acting.”
“I'd like to be remembered as somebody who entertained — who took one out of oneself — for a few minutes, a few hours — transported you into a different venue — gave you relief, gave you entertainment, and gave you joy and laughter, and tears — all those things. I would like to be remembered as somebody who was — capable of doing that.”
